Living On Campus


Residence Hall Services

Front Desks: Each hall has a front desk located in the main lobby. Services provided include emergency assistance, check-out of sports equipment, VCR and vacuum cleaner.

Housekeeping: The University provides a housekeeping service to clean all of the general use areas, such as the bathrooms, lobby and lounges.

Kitchens: Kitchen facilities are available for use in Brandt and Stu-Han. In the Oaks, each floor has a kitchen area for your use.

Laundry Facilities: All of the Residence Halls are equipped with coin-operated washing machines and dryers in each building.

Lounges: Each lounge is equipped with sofas and chairs for studying or recreation. There are televisions, pool tables, and other games available in the lounges for use by residents.

Mailboxes: All students who live on campus must obtain a mailbox, located in the Student Center.

Parking: All vehicles that are parked on University property must display a current year parking permit. Permits are $20.00 and can be obtained through the Campus Safety Office.

Telephones: Campuslink is the phone company that provides phone services for students that live in the residence halls. For details and sign-up visit this page...

Vending Machines: Drink machines are provided in Stu-Han, Brandt and the Oaks lobbies. A snack machine is provided in the main lobby of Stu-Han and "B" Lounge in the Oaks.

Costs

Room and board fee includes all utilities and local telephone calls. The price of a double occupancy space, on the average, is less than most off campus options. The housing license agreement is for a 9-month academic year, not a 12-month calendar year.
